To facilitate the use of small businesses under TESS, Booz Allen offers the following–

  • We have a Small Business Office that maintains an online portal and registration process for all companies interested in working with us.
  • Our SBO has again received a rating of Highly Successful from the Defense Contract Management Agency (DCMA) and the Small Business Administration (SBA) on our most recent (May 2007) audit by DCMA.
  • Since the inception of our mentor-protégé programs, we have successfully mentored more than 25 protégé firms through our various programs. In fact, the Department of Defense (DoD), Office of Small Business Programs, awarded Booz Allen the Nunn-Perry Award in 2005 for the success of its mentor-protégé relationship with a woman-owned, small disadvantaged IT firm.  Booz Allen won the award again, in March 2008, for the success of its mentor-protégé relationship with a US Army protégé, one of the TESS teammates. And in 2010, we earned the third Nunn-Perry Award for the third year in a row.
